Found out I'm missing the bolt that holds the shifter rod locked in place so you can shift. From under the jeep if you follow the rod that comes from the shifter, you will find a block that has a bolt in it. That bolt is used to keep that rod from just sliding back and forth when you shift. Can anyone tell me what size this bolt is?

You're talking about bolt in the part that pinches the rod, that you'd move to adjust the shifter, right? The 1991 parts catalog just says "screw". The 97/99 parts catalog says its a 5/16-18 x0.5" bolt.
